6.14 REMOTE CONTROL (OPTIONAL)
Fig. 44
On request the stove may be supplied with a remote control, which can
be used to govern certain stove functions.
- Startup/Shutdown: by pressing the two + keys simultaneously the
stove can be turned on or off.
- Power level: when operating normally, pressing the + and - keys
above the ame symbol will select one of the four power levels of
the stove.
- Temperature: when operating normally, pressing the + and -
keys above the thermometer symbol will select the desired room
temperature (44° F and 86° F - 7° C and 30° C).

6.15 SAFETy dEvICES
a During operation some parts of the stove (door, handle, ceramic parts) can reach high temperatures.
Remember to maintain the safety distances indicated previously.
Be careful, take all due precautions and always comply with the instructions.
If during operation smoke leaks from any part of the stove or the ue, shut the stove down immediately and ventilate the room. When the stove has
cooled, check for the cause of the leak and if necessary call in specialist personnel.
The stove is tted with several safety devices to guarantee safe operation.
a The safety devices are tted to eliminate the risk of injury to people and pets and damage to property. Tampering or work carried out
by unauthorised personnel can jeopardise this function.
d IN CASE OF ANY ALARM SIGNALS DO NOT UNPLUG THE STOVE: JUST TURN THE UNIT OFF.

Connected to the ue gas outlet, its function is to control the vacuum inside the outlet
duct so that the stove can be used in all safety.
If correct operating conditions in the ue gas outlet change (incorrect installation,
blockages or obstructions in the ue, poor maintenance, unfavourable weather
conditions such as persistent wind, etc.) the pressure switch cuts off the power supply
to the fuel-loading auger, thereby stopping the supply of pellets to the grate and
starting the stove shutdown process.
- The readout “ALF 1” appears in the STOVE STATUS mode.
- The readout “SAFETY SMOKE“ appears on the display.
- After approx. 60 seconds the alarm sounds (if activated).
SAFETY SMOKE
WHAT TO DO:
- Shut down the stove by holding the ON/OFF key down for several seconds.
- The alarm stops.
- Wait until you are sure that combustion of any pellets remaining in the grate has
stopped.
- Wait until the stove has cooled down, then check for and remove whatever has
caused the safety device to be triggered. Finally, after having cleaned the grate
restart the stove by pressing the ON/OFF key.
